suse ftp服务配置:[环境搭建]安装MOTODEV Studio for Android (官网教程)

来源:百度文库 编辑:中财网 时间:2024/04/20 02:01:34

可将 MOTODEV Studio for Android 作为一个独立的应用程序进行安装,也可以将其作为一组插件安装到现有的 Eclipse 中。 如果您现在安装有 Eclipse 并想要向其中添加 MOTODEV Studio for Android,则可以向下跳到作为插件安装 MOTODEV Studio来获取相关说明。 否则,按照作为应用程序安装 MOTODEV Studio下面的说明,将 MOTODEV Studio for Android 作为一个独立的应用程序进行安装。

必须装有 Java 6 才能安装 MOTODEV Studio。请注意,尽管大多数 MOTODEV Studio for Android 功能在您仅安装 JRE (Java Runtime Environment) 的情况下仍可以工作,但一些功能(例如,ProGuard 代码迷惑)需要完整的 JDK (Java Development Kit)。 Motorola Mobility 建议在您的开发计算机上安装 JDK。

已测试的配置

MOTODEV Studio for Android 针对与以下系统的兼容性进行了测试。 尽管 MOTODEV Studio 可能会与其他配置和系统兼容,但我们只保证支持下述系统。

  • Microsoft Windows 7 Professional,32 位和 64 位版本
  • Microsoft Windows XP Professional SP3,32 位
  • Mac OS X 10.6.4,64 位
  • Mac OS X 10.5.8,32 位
  • 运行 GNOME 的 Ubuntu 10.10,32 位和 64 位版本

所有的测试系统都具有 Intel? Core? 2 Duo CPU、2 GB 或更多 RAM(对于 Mac OS X 则为 4 GB)、最新的 Java? SE Development Kit (JDK) 以及 1.5 GB 以上的可用磁盘空间(MOTODEV Studio 自身仅需要 200 MB,但为了安装 MOTODEV Studio for Android 和 Google 的 Android SDK 和插件,却至少需要 1.5 GB 的可用磁盘空间)。

作为应用程序安装 MOTODEV Studio

MOTODEV Studio for Android 安装过程因您的基础操作系统而略有不同。 安装 MOTODEV Studio 之后,安装或配置 Android SDK 的过程(记述在安装 Android SDK 下)是相同的,与操作系统无关。

如果您已经安装了 MOTODEV Studio for Android 的早期版本,则可能需要将其卸载。 尽管两个版本也许能够共存,但我们不会进行此类测试,因此不支持在一台计算机上安装 MOTODEV Studio for Android 的多个版本。 不要将 MOTODEV Studio 安装在含现有 MOTODEV Studio 版本或其他内容的文件夹中。 始终都要将其安装在新文件夹中。

安装和使用 MOTODEV Studio 之前,请仔细通读此安装指南和发行说明(可在MOTODEV Studio 下载页上找到)。

Microsoft Windows

首先决定是要安装 32 位还是 64 位版 MOTODEV Studio。 然后下载相应 MOTODEV Studio for Android 版本,双击所下载的可执行文件,然后按照屏幕上的说明操作。

现在转到安装 Android SDK。

Mac OS X

首先决定是要安装 32 位还是 64 位版 MOTODEV Studio。Apple 说明了如何辨别您的计算机使用的是 32 位还是 64 位内核。

要安装,请下载 MOTODEV Studio for Android,双击所下载的可执行文件(是一个 jar 文件),然后按照屏幕上的说明操作。

在安装期间,如果您看到motodevstudio 想要使用存储在密钥链中的“equinox.secure.storage”中的机密信息,请单击总是允许。 此消息来自于 Eclipse,是在询问是否应使用标准操作系统机制来存储用来对您的机密信息进行加密的密码,例如,代理用户名和密码。

现在转到安装 Android SDK。

Linux

首先决定是要安装 32 位还是 64 位版 MOTODEV Studio。 然后下载相应 MOTODEV Studio for Android 版本,双击所下载的可执行文件,然后按照屏幕上的说明操作。

如果您要将手机连接到开发计算机,则还需要定义具体 udev 规则,使手机可由具有读写权限的 MOTODEV Studio for Android 访问:

  1. /etc/udev/rules.d/ 目录中创建一个名为 51-android.rules 的文件。
  2. 编辑上述文件以便它包含以下行:
    SUBSYSTEM=="usb", ATTRS{idVendor}==vendor_id, MODE="0666"
    使用您的设备的供应商 ID 替换 vendor_id。 Motorola 的供应商 ID 为 "22b8"。 HTC G1 手机的供应商 ID 为 "0bb4"。 请注意,供应商 ID 必须用双引号引起来。
  3. 保存该文件。

根据 Linux 分发的不同,要在 51-android.rules 中输入的行可能会有所不同。 一些 udev 的早期版本使用 SYSFS 来查询设备属性,而较新的版本则使用 ATTRS。 另外,还可能需要将子系统名称更改为“usb_device”。 这样,该行可能需要为:

SUBSYSTEM="usb_device", SYSFS {idVendor}==vendor_id, MODE="0666"

现在转到安装 Android SDK。

作为插件安装 MOTODEV Studio

MOTODEV Studio for Android 还可用作一组插件,可使用 Eclipse 的标准更新机制将这些插件添加到 Eclipse 的现有安装中。 您可直接通过 Internet 或通过您已从 MOTODEV 网站下载的存档文件安装这些插件。

  1. 确保您具有 Eclipse 的正确版本。 仅可将 MOTODEV Studio for Android 插件(除了 1.2.1 版插件)安装到 Eclipse Helios (3.6) 中。

    请注意,如果要通过含有插件的 zip 存档文件安装,但没有 Internet 连接,则必须已有 Eclipse 3.6.2。 否则必须先更新 Eclipse: zip 存档文件中不含任何 Eclipse 程序包。

  2. 如果您的 Eclipse 已安装 Google 的 ADT 插件,并且该插件与 MOTODEV Studio for Android 所使用的插件的版本不同(请参见发行说明来了解 MOTODEV Studio 使用的版本号),则卸载该插件。 MOTODEV Studio for Android 插件会从 Google 下载并安装最新的 ADT,现有的安装可能会与之发生冲突。 有关卸载 ADT 插件的说明,请参见 Google 的联机文档中的卸载 ADT 插件。
  3. 在 Eclipse 的帮助菜单中,选择安装新软件。
    将出现“可用软件”对话框。
  4. 单击添加(在使用字段的右侧)。
    将出现“添加网站”对话框。
  5. 指定 MOTODEV Studio 插件的位置。
    • 如果要通过 Internet 安装插件,则将以下 URL 输入位置字段,并单击确定
      https://studio-android.motodevupdate.com/android/2.2
      请注意,将会要求您登录。请提供您的 MOTODEV 登录名和密码。

    • 如果要通过存档文件安装插件,则单击存档,并选择您以前从 MOTODEV 网站中下载的存档文件。 然后,在“添加网站”对话框中单击确定
    根据您的网络,通过存档文件安装插件可能需要很长时间。 要在此特定情况下加快安装速度,请在安装的过程中禁用网络并清除“联系所有更新网站”选项。

    回到“安装”对话框,确保已启用按类别选项分组项目。 MOTODEV Studio for Android 现在应会在对话框的中央列出。 如果未将其列出,并且您正在通过 Internet 安装插件,则您可能没有从 Eclipse 内访问 MOTODEV 网站的权限。 如有必要,请切换到常规 > 网络连接首选项对话框,然后进行任何所需的调整。 或者,下载插件存档文件并用其进行安装。

  6. 选中“MOTODEV Studio for Android”左侧的复选框(这将选择构成 MOTODEV Studio for Android 的所有功能: MOTODEV Studio 自身、应用程序验证程序以及这二者的集成)。 单击下一步。
    假定一切都正确,则将显示 安装详细信息页。
  7. 单击下一步。
    将显示要仔细查看的许可协议。
  8. 仔细查看每个协议的条款。 如果您接受这些条款,则选择相应的选项,并单击完成。
    将开始下载和安装 MOTODEV Studio for Android 插件。
  9. 完成 MOTODEV Studio for Android 插件的安装之后,系统将会提示您重新启动。 单击是以重新启动 Eclipse 并使新插件生效。

现在转到安装 Android SDK。

安装 Android SDK

MOTODEV Studio for Android 在启动时将会检查您的工作区[1] 中是否有对 SDK 的引用。 如果您的工作区没有引用 SDK,则 MOTODEV Studio for Android 会在装有 MOTODEV Studio for Android 的目录中查找 SDK。 如果未找到 SDK,则它会显示“下载组件”对话框,从中可以下载 SDK 或指定您的硬盘驱动器上已有的 SDK 的位置。

如果您所在的网络需要代理身份验证,则只有在手动为 HTTP 和 HTTPS 连接设置(在常规 > 网络连接下的首选项中)代理信息(包括用户名和密码)的情况下, MOTODEV Studio 才能下载并安装 SDK。 如果在安装期间询问您是否想要更改连接首选项,请选择更改。 将当前提供程序更改为“手动”,然后为 HTTP 和 HTTPS 方案提供主机、端口、用户和密码值。

使用“下载组件”对话框执行以下操作之一:

  • 使用您的开发计算机上的现有 Android SDK: 如果您选择了某个 Android SDK,则可能需要检查该 SDK 的更新。 请参见下面的 Android SDK 更新。
    1. 选择 SDK 位置。
    2. 使用所提供的字段指定要使用的 SDK 的位置。
    3. 单击确定。
      MOTODEV Studio for Android 将您的工作区配置为使用选定的 SDK。
    4. 如果未与所选 SDK 关联任何下载的平台,则会询问是否要打开 Android SDK and AVD Manager,以便下载一个或多个平台。 如果会询问:
      1. 请单击是。
        将打开 Android SDK and AVD Manager。
      2. 在“Android SDK and AVD Manager”对话框左侧,选择可用包。
      3. 在“Android SDK and AVD Manager”对话框右侧,单击 Android 存储库复选框左侧的三角,以显示其内容。
      4. 选择所需平台和示例程序包(如果都要安装,则单击 Android 存储库左侧的复选框)。
      5. 单击安装选定的组件。 显示确认对话框时单击安装。
  • 下载 SDK 并安装一个或多个 Android 平台:
    1. 单击下载。
    2. 请求时指定要在开发计算机中存储下载的 SDK 的位置。
      SDK 和平台工具会下载到计算机中并存储在指定的位置。
    3. 现在会询问是否要打开 Android SDK and AVD Manager,以便下载一个或多个平台。 请单击是。
      将打开 Android SDK and AVD Manager。
    4. 在“Android SDK and AVD Manager”对话框左侧,选择可用包。
    5. 在“Android SDK and AVD Manager”对话框右侧,单击 Android 存储库复选框左侧的三角,以显示其内容。
    6. 选择所需平台和示例程序包(如果都要安装,则单击 Android 存储库左侧的复选框)。
    7. 单击安装选定的组件。 显示确认对话框时单击安装。
  • 要完全跳过此步骤(并在以后安装 SDK),请单击“下载组件”对话框中的取消。 请注意,虽然您将能够启动 MOTODEV Studio for Android,但是在您安装并配置 SDK 之前,您将无法创建 Android 项目,运行仿真程序,或执行需要 Android 工具和库的任何其他任务。 如果您后来又下载 SDK,则可以通过从窗口菜单中选择首选项,然后再从首选项列表中选择 Android,告诉 MOTODEV Studio 装有该 SDK 的位置。

安装语言包和其他组件

如果已在安装过程中指定备选语言(如中文、西班牙语或巴西葡萄牙语),则 MOTODEV Studio for Android 会安装相应语言包。 如果要添加其他语言包,或者安装示例代码或本机 (C/C++) 开发支持文件,请使用 MOTODEV Studio 的“下载组件”功能:

  1. 启动 MOTODEV Studio for Android。
  2. 在 MOTODEV 菜单中,选择下载组件。
  3. 在“下载组件”对话框的左侧,单击所需选项。 在对话框右侧,选中要安装的特定语言包或组件。
  4. 全部所需选择操作都执行完后,单击下载组件对话框中的确定。

通过非默认语言运行 MOTODEV Studio

如果安装了相应于您的系统语言的语言包,则 MOTODEV Studio for Android 默认使用您的系统语言;否则,将默认使用英语。 您可以通过以下方法从命令行中使用其他语言来启动 MOTODEV Studio for Android:提供 -nl 参数并指定相应于某种已安装的语言包的 IETF 语言标记(例如,指定 -nl pt_BR 即可通过巴西葡萄牙语运行)。 如果您想要始终使用默认语言之外的其他语言启动 MOTODEV Studio for Android,则只需更改相应的快捷方式以反映您要使用的语言:

  • 在 Microsoft Windows 中,用鼠标右键单击相应的快捷方式(桌面和/或快速启动快捷方式),然后选择属性。 在目标字段中,将 -nl 参数后面的语言标记替换为您要使用的标记(“es”代表西班牙语,“zh”代表中文,“pt_BR”代表巴西葡萄牙语)。
  • 在 Linux 或 Mac OS X 中,编辑 motodevstudio.sh 脚本(位于 MOTODEV Studio for Android 安装文件夹中),取消 LANGUAGE 变量定义的注释,按需修改其值。 将其设置为“-nl ”(将其中的 相应替换为代表西班牙语的“es”,代表中文的“zh”以及代表巴西葡萄牙语的“pt_BR”)
MOTODEV Studio for Android 由来自 Eclipse、Motorola Mobility, Inc. 和 Google 的各种组件构成。当您选择语言包时,所列出的语言将是有 Eclipse 组件译文的语言。 来自 Motorola 和 Google 的组件未必经过翻译。 因此,根据您所选择的语言,您可能会看到一些对话框使用选定的语言显示,而其他对话框使用英语显示。

检查更新

您可以随时检查对 MOTODEV Studio for Android 或平台以及您已安装的 SDK 的更新。但请注意,从 MOTODEV Studio for Android 的一个版本到另一个版本的更新仅支持某些发行版。 只有列在 MOTODEV Studio for Android 下载页上的更新才受支持。 否则,您必须执行完全安装。

MOTODEV Studio 更新

MOTODEV Studio 对某些更新采用了 Eclipse 更新机制(请阅读上面的“检查更新”)。

  1. 选择 MOTODEV 菜单中的更新 MOTODEV Studio for Android。 如果有更新,则会出现“可用更新”对话框。 如果未出现该对话框,则表明没有任何更新或 Eclipse 无法联系更新服务器。

    要检查网络问题,请转到安装/更新 > 可用软件网站首选项,从软件网站列表中选择 MOTODEV Studio for Android <版本> 更新,然后单击测试连接。 请注意,如果您的计算机通过代理访问 Internet,则您可能需要更新 Eclipse 的代理设置。 可在常规 > 网络连接首选项中找到代理设置。

    如果检查更新时看到进度条卡在 20% ,则是在等待用户提供 MOTODEV 登录凭据。 请查找登录对话框(可能隐藏在其他对话框之后),然后登录。
  2. 现在将会显示有关更新的许可协议。 仔细查看该许可协议,如果您同意许可协议,则选择我接受许可协议的条款,然后单击完成。

现在将下载并安装更新。 对于有些更新,可能会向您发出通知,建议重新启动 MOTODEV Studio for Android。 通常需要单击是以重新启动 MOTODEV Studio。

Android SDK 更新

可用 Android SDK and AVD Manager 检查新的和已更新的 Android SDK 组件,如添加 SDK 组件下的 Android 文档所述。

  1. 从窗口菜单中选择 Android SDK and AVD Manager。 将打开 Android SDK and AVD Manager。
  2. 在左窗格中选择可用包。 右窗格将显示可下载的所有组件。
    如果您所在的网络需要进行代理身份验证,则只有在手动为 HTTP 和 HTTPS 连接设置(在常规 > 网络连接下的首选项中)代理信息(包括用户名和密码)的情况下,Android SDK and AVD Manager 才能列出、下载和安装新组件。 将当前提供程序更改为“手动”,然后为 HTTP 和 HTTPS 方案提供主机、端口、用户和密码值。
  3. 确保选中仅显示更新。 这会将显示的组件列表限制为那些当前未安装的组件。
  4. 选择您要安装的那些组件,并单击安装选定的组件。 将列出选定的组件以便确认。
  5. 单击安装接受的组件。 现在将安装选定的组件。

卸载

  1. 启动卸载程序。
    • 在 Microsoft Windows 中,单击开始,然后依次选择所有程序 > MOTODEV Studio > MOTODEV Studio for Android 版本 > 卸载 MOTODEV Studio for Android 版本。
    • 在 Mac OS X 中,双击应用程序/MOTODEV_Studio_for_Android_版本/uninstaller.jar。
    • 在 Linux 中,单击窗口系统的应用程序菜单,然后依次选择程序 > MOTODEV Studio > MOTODEV Studio for Android 版本 > 卸载 MOTODEV Studio for Android 版本
    会显示卸载向导。
  2. 单击卸载。
    将开始执行卸载过程。
  3. 完成卸载时单击完成退出卸载程序。
 

脚注

1. 工作区是包含项目和 MOTODEV Studio 所使用的各种设置的目录。 在这些设置中有对 Android SDK 的引用。